Dark Background Logo
User Experience with Next.js: Building Fast and Responsive Web Interfaces

User Experience with Next.js: Building Fast and Responsive Web Interfaces

User Experience with Next.js helps to create web applications that load quickly and work smoothly across devices. It improves usability through efficient rendering and routing.

Know What we do

Understanding User Experience with Next.js in Modern Web Development

User Experience with Next.js refers to how users interact with applications developed using the Next.js framework. It includes factors such as page load speed, navigation flow, and responsiveness across devices. Next.js provides rendering methods like server-side rendering and static generation, which reduce delays and improve the initial load experience. By organizing pages efficiently and handling data flow effectively, developers can build interfaces that remain smooth and consistent. This approach is important for applications where performance and usability influence user engagement and retention.

A strong user experience in Next.js depends on how routing, rendering, and component structure are arranged. Built-in routing simplifies navigation between pages, while efficient rendering helps to deliver content quickly. Developers also work on minimizing unnecessary re-renders and handling state effectively to keep interactions responsive. Capabilities like code splitting and image optimization help reduce load times and improve performance. When these elements work together, the application becomes easier to use, with fewer delays and more predictable behavior.

Improving user experience with Next.js in real scenarios requires handling speed, usability, and code quality together. Teams observe page behavior across varying network conditions and refine assets where needed. A structured codebase and reusable components help keep the application uniform. Backend systems and APIs are integrated to serve dynamic content without affecting response time. This allows applications to expand with user demand while remaining responsive.

Practical Approach to Improving User Experience with Next.js

Practical Approach to Improving User Experience with Next.js

Improving user experience with Next.js starts with setting up a clear application structure that can grow over time and is easy to work with. A well-arranged routing system helps to manage pages, layouts, and reusable components in an organized way. This allows users to move across the interface without delays or uneven behavior. Setting up the structure early also makes it easier for frontend and backend teams to work together and create features in a coordinated manner while keeping behavior consistent across the application.

Efficient data handling is essential for delivering a smooth experience. Using APIs or server-side logic to manage requests assures that data is fetched and displayed without unnecessary delays. Choosing appropriate rendering methods such as server-side rendering or static generation helps balance performance and responsiveness. When applied correctly, these strategies reduce load times and improve how quickly users can interact with content. This helps the interface to stay smooth and responsive, even when data updates quickly across different pages.

Optimizing components and monitoring performance are key to sustaining long-term results. Reusable components with efficient state management help reduce unnecessary updates and improve rendering behavior. At the same time, tracking metrics such as page load time, responsiveness, and user interactions allows teams to find bottlenecks early. Continuous refinement based on these insights assures the application remains efficient as it scales. This approach supports consistent performance and helps maintain a high-quality experience across different devices and usage conditions.

Practical Implementation Steps:

  • Structure pages, layouts, and components using a clear routing system
  • Manage data flow through APIs or server-side functions for consistent communication
  • Apply SSR or SSG based on performance and content requirements
  • Build reusable components with optimized state handling to reduce re-renders
  • Track performance metrics and refine rendering and data strategies over time

Enhancing Next.js User Experience Through Performance and Optimization

Enhancing Next.js User Experience Through Performance and Optimization

A good Next.js user experience comes down to how well the application handles performance as it grows. Things like loading assets properly, splitting code, and handling images help to reduce load time and keep the interface quick. This makes it easier for users to access content, even on slower devices or networks. When performance is considered early, the application stays agile and consistent across pages.

Rendering strategies have a direct impact on how users experience speed and interaction. Using server-side rendering or static generation based on content needs helps to control how quickly information appears. Managing caching layers and reducing repeated data requests improves efficiency.

Many teams working with nextjs development services base their rendering choices on real usage patterns so content loads quickly while the application stays stable across different environments.

Apart from performance, consistency in interaction design helps to create a reliable experience. Smooth transitions, predictable navigation, and stable layouts reduce confusion and improve usability. Tracking real-time performance metrics and adjusting interface behavior helps applications respond to changing user expectations. This ongoing effort keeps applications efficient, responsive, and in line with long term product goals while offering a smooth experience across devices.

Applying Next.js for Scalable User Experience Across Industries

Applying Next.js for Scalable User Experience Across Industries

Next.js is used across industries where performance and consistency play a direct role in user engagement. For online shopping platforms, quick page loads and smooth navigation improve browsing and checkout flows. In SaaS applications, organized routing and efficient rendering help to keep things steady as usage grows. Content-heavy platforms benefit from faster content delivery, making information easier to access. 

User expectations change across industries, but fast response and dependable performance stay important. In finance and healthcare, applications need steady interfaces that handle frequent data updates without delays.

Media platforms prioritize quick content delivery. Teams rely on Next.js to manage these needs using different rendering methods and efficient data handling. A well-planned architecture helps applications perform consistently as they become more complex.

As applications grow over time, keeping a consistent user experience becomes more complex. Increased traffic, more data, and added features can impact performance if not handled well. Using well-defined frontend practices along with steady backend communication helps keep systems stable. Many organizations turn to node js web development services to manage backend operations, keeping data flow and delivery efficient. This frontend–backend setup keeps performance stable and the experience consistent.

Ensuring Reliable User Experience with Next.js for Long-Term Scalability

Ensuring Reliable User Experience with Next.js for Long-Term Scalability

User experience in Next.js over time depends on managing speed, growth, and system stability. Changes in traffic and features can affect responsiveness as applications develop. Planning ahead helps to reduce slowdowns and keeps interfaces stable as usage increases. Coordinating frontend behavior with backend processes helps keep the experience steady across different scenarios.

Reliability is also influenced by how well applications are monitored and optimized over time. Tracking performance metrics such as load time, interaction speed, and system response helps to find areas that need improvement. Regular updates to rendering strategies, caching mechanisms, and data handling approaches ensure that the application continues to perform efficiently. This ongoing refinement supports consistent usability, even as requirements and user expectations change.

A long-term approach to user experience centers on adaptability and continuous updates. Teams adjust workflows, improve components, and refine interactions to keep the experience consistent. As systems grow, clear navigation and stable performance become critical. With well-defined processes, Next.js applications can continue to deliver dependable experiences while meeting future growth and changing business needs.

Core Factors Behind Reliable and Scalable Next.js Applications

  • Plan scalability early to avoid performance issues as applications grow.
  • Monitor load time, responsiveness, and interaction patterns consistently.
  • Refine rendering and caching strategies based on real usage data.
  • Maintain consistent navigation and interface behavior across updates.
  • Align frontend and backend processes for stable performance.

Next.js vs Traditional Web Apps in User Experience

Compare how Next.js improves performance, rendering, and overall user experience over traditional web application approaches.

Rendering

Uses SSR, SSG, and hybrid methods for faster content delivery

Primarily client-side rendering with slower initial load

Performance

Optimized with code splitting, caching, and asset handling

Requires manual optimization, often less efficient

User Experience

Smooth navigation with faster interactions

Slower transitions and delayed content rendering

Scalability

Built for modular and scalable application growth

Scaling requires additional setup and restructuring

Take it to the next level.

Build Better User Experience with Next.js for Scalable Applications

Work with teams offering next js development services to build fast, responsive, and scalable web applications.

Experts Behind Scalable User Experience with Next.js

Building a strong user experience with Next.js involves a clear plan and capable teams. Specialists manage speed, rendering methods, and system setup so applications stay fast, handle higher usage, and keep behavior consistent across devices.

Staff Augmentation

Bring in skilled developers to improve performance, refine rendering, and enhance user experience in Next.js applications.

Build Operate Transfer

Set up and manage dedicated teams for Next.js development, then transition them smoothly as your needs evolve.

Offshore Development Centre

Work with global teams to scale development while maintaining consistency in performance and delivery.

Product Development Centre

Build applications with performance, scalability, and user experience integrated into the development process.

Managed Services

Maintain performance through ongoing monitoring, updates, and improvements across applications.

Global Capability Centre

Manage distributed teams through a centralized setup to ensure consistent development and execution.

Capabilities

  • Optimize rendering strategies for faster load and interaction.

  • Improve application scalability and performance consistency.

  • Enhance component structure and interaction flow.

  • Align frontend and backend for stable user experience.

Work with experienced teams to build applications that grow well and deliver consistent user experiences.

Tech Industries

Industrial Applications

Next.js is widely used across industries where performance, responsiveness, and consistency shape user engagement. From online commerce and finance to healthcare and SaaS platforms, it delivers fast-loading interfaces and stable interactions. Its different rendering methods and data handling approaches help applications handle varied use cases while keeping usability consistent across devices.

Clients

Clients we engaged with

Take it to the next level.

Enhance Web Application Performance and Experience with Next.js

Next.js helps build fast, responsive web applications that handle growth by improving rendering, data handling, and interface performance across devices and use cases.

Share Blogs

Related Blogs

UI Development Thumbnail

UI Development Services

Elevate user experiences with UI Development Services, designing interactive, responsive, and visually consistent applications for better engagement.

Common Queries

Frequently Asked Questions

UI Development Faq

Find answers on performance, scalability, and building better web experiences with Next.js.

Next.js improves performance through optimized rendering methods like server-side rendering and static generation. It reduces load time, enables faster interactions, and ensures consistent behavior across pages. These improvements directly enhance usability and engagement in modern web applications.

Next.js is a strong choice when applications require fast loading, scalable architecture, and consistent user interactions. It is commonly used for platforms that handle dynamic content, frequent updates, or growing user traffic. Teams offering react js development services often use similar component-based approaches to build scalable interfaces.

Next.js supports structured API handling and server-side logic, allowing efficient data exchange between frontend and backend systems. Many applications rely on node js web development services to manage backend operations and ensure consistent data flow.

Next.js supports modular architecture, flexible rendering strategies, and performance optimization techniques that help applications scale efficiently. It works well alongside nextjs development services that focus on optimizing rendering and improving application performance over time.

Yes, Next.js is widely used to build high-performance interfaces due to its optimized rendering, efficient routing, and ability to manage assets effectively. These features help maintain smooth interactions and responsive user experiences.

Explore

Insights

Learn how performance-focused development improves responsiveness and keeps applications consistent as they scale over time.